On Fri, May 04, 2018 at 12:35:05PM -0500, Eric Sandeen wrote:
> Add an xfs_dqblk verifier so that it can check the uuid on V5 filesystems;
> it calls the existing xfs_dquot_verify verifier to validate the
> xfs_disk_dquot_t contained inside it. This lets us move the uuid
> verification out of the crc verifier, which makes little sense.
